There’s the site of the Battle of Hastings, the blue bell woods of the South Downs, the homes of Rudyard Kipling and Virginia Woolf, the smugglers caves at St. Clements, Salisbury Cathedral, and the New Forest.
The New Forest is England’s newest National Park and covers over 140,000 acres of land. Historically common land, the New Forest provides a home to five species of wild deer as well as the famous New Forest pony and other rare animals.
